Thursday, February 2, 2023
Members of the American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A) elected WHA Information Center (WHAIC) Vice President Jennifer Mueller, MBA, RHIA, SHIMSS, FACHE, FAHIMA, as president/chair of the 2023 Board of Directors. Her one-year term began Jan. 1.
Mueller has been the vice president and privacy officer at WHAIC for the last five years. Prior to that, she was the vice president and chief information officer at Watertown Regional Medical Center in Watertown. As an active member of the Wisconsin Health Information Management Association (WHIMA), Mueller previously served as president of the WHIMA Board of Directors and has received several of the chapter’s awards recognizing excellence in the health information profession and service to the chapter. Those awards include the WHIMA Rising Star Award, Motivator Award, and Distinguished Member Award. Additionally, she is an active member of the Wisconsin chapter of the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society and the HIPAA Collaborative of Wisconsin.
“I am honored to lead AHIMA at this time of breathtaking evolution in health care,” said Mueller. “Health information professionals are uniquely positioned to balance technology and data's tremendous power and potential with our responsibility to every patient as stewards of their health information.”
AHIMA is a global nonprofit association of health information professionals with more than 71,000 members.
